Overview: Train from New Malden to Basingstoke
Trains from New Malden to Basingstoke run on average 3 times per day, taking around 1h 0m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at £41 but you can travel from only £26 by coach.
The earliest train runs at 00:41, the last at 22:35. The fastest train covers the 59 km distance in 53m.
